Mesa police arrest 1 after repo man pistol-whipped

MESA, AZ– Police arrested a man after an altercation led to a victim being pistol-whipped outside a Mesa restaurant Friday.

Mesa Police Sgt. Ed Wessing said the victim was apparently trying to repossess a vehicle outside a Macaroni Grill near Baseline Road and Stapley Drive around 2:30 p.m.

The suspect was reportedly walking up to his vehicle and saw a man near it.

He apparently thought he was being robbed and approached the man near his vehicle where an altercation took place, according to Wessing.

Wessing said the suspect allegedly the struck the repossession man with a pistol and the weapon discharged.

The victim was taken to a local hospital with a cut to his head, Wessing said.

The owner of the vehicle drove off, but officers caught up with him near the U.S. 60 and Country Club Drive where he was arrested, Wessing said.

He reportedly claimed he didn’t know the man was repossessing his vehicle.
